A blood–brain barrier- and blood–brain tumor barrier-penetrating siRNA delivery system targeting gliomas for brain tumor immunotherapy (2024)

Peptide

Cholesterol-DP7-Gly6-T7 peptide

Sequence: cholesterol-VQWRIRVAVIRK-Gly6-HAIYPRH

RNA

siRNA (Cy5-labeled for biodistribution imaging)

Rna Concentration 1 mg/kg cy5-siRNA i.v.; 4 h biodistribution readout.
Mixing Ratio Peptide:siRNA mass ratio 10:1 (incubated before i.v. administration).
Formulation Format Cholesterol-peptide/siRNA complex (electrostatic)
Formulation Components Cholesterol-DP7-Gly6-T7 peptide complexed with cy5-siRNA for BBB/BBTB penetration screening. Gly6 linker between DP7 and T7.

Animal Model Normal mice and/or GL261 tumor-bearing mice (biodistribution imaging at 4 h).
Administration Route Intravenous (i.v.) single dose; organs collected at 4 h for IVIS imaging and brain section CLSM.
Output Type In vivo biodistribution: brain fluorescence signal after i.v. administration (BBB/BBTB penetration screening).
Output Value Brain accumulation signal detected; DAT (DP7-ACP-T7) reported as strongest among tested peptide/linker configurations.
Output Units
Output Notes Screening used DP7 and T7 as target heads with different linkers (ACP, PEG2, Gly6) and orientations.
